Talk to a Psychiatrist

If you have been feeling depressed for more than 2 weeks or when your symptoms interfere with your day-to-day activities it is crucial to seek help. A psychiatrist is a health professional who can provide you with a complete evaluation, accurate diagnosis and a dependable treatment. In addition to prescribing medication, a psychiatrist may also recommend psychotherapy.

The first encounter with a psychiatrist will be unlike a regular doctor's appointment, but instead of conducting a physical exam the psychiatrist will ask you questions regarding your symptoms and emotions. It's important to be open and honest with your answers.

Once your doctor has a better understanding of your symptoms they'll be able to begin drafting a medical treatment plan for you. The plan could include medication to alleviate depression and correct the chemical imbalances that are present in your brain. The medication prescribed will depend on your symptoms and medical history, as well as if you have any other conditions or illnesses causing your symptoms.

Many individuals with depression may find that their symptoms improve with lifestyle changes, talking therapies, and/or medications. Keep a Journal

The act of writing down thoughts and feelings is an outlet for some people and a journal is an appropriate method to do this. Journals can also be an opportunity to write down ideas that are too difficult or difficult to discuss in other settings, like with a therapist during weekly sessions. It is important to choose a journaling format that suits your preferences. For example, some people prefer using a prompt for journaling that can help to guide them, whereas others may prefer free-writing.

In addition to allowing individuals to share their feelings in a safe environment Journals can also aid in identifying patterns. By recording the way they feel throughout the day, they can spot triggers and warning indicators of depression. This can help people avoid or manage depression in the future. It also gives loved-ones insight into what's happening.

Some people find that keeping a journal is more beneficial when they are feeling particularly angry, such as following a breakup or the loss of a job. If they're struggling and need to vent, a journal can be an ideal place to talk about the emotions they are having and to remind them that the feelings will be over. Writing down positive self-talk is also a great method to boost moods and divert attention away from negative thoughts.

Stay Active

If you're feeling depressed, doing exercise isn't something you'd like to do. However, exercise can release endorphins that can improve your mood. If you're not sure where to begin, speak to an exercise physiologist or physiotherapist. They can assist you in planning your schedule, offer advice and suggest a fitness program.

Another important depression management strategy is to get enough rest. Studies have proven that a lack of sleep causes and intensifies symptoms. If you are having difficulty sleeping, you should alter your routine or look into an alternative treatment like massage, light therapy or acupuncture.

You should also avoid drinking and taking recreational drugs as they can make your depression worse. It is also essential to eat a balanced diet and take any supplements recommended by your doctor. It's important to recognize any warning symptoms of depression and seek immediate assistance.

Stay Connected

Depression can make it tempting to withdraw and isolate from loved ones, but staying in touch is crucial. Face-to-face interaction with family and friends is ideal however if it's not possible telephone calls and video chats are a great alternative. Find ways to help others. It's satisfying and can improve your mood.

Participating in a support groups is another way to get and give encouragement and also to offer and receive advice regarding managing depression. A lot of online therapy platforms allow you to talk to therapists through virtual conversations if you feel uncomfortable in large groups.

Socializing can improve your mood, whether that's making a quick call to an old friend or joining a sports club. Even when you're not feeling like doing these things, it's crucial to incorporate these activities into your routine.

Sleep is an important part of mental health. However, it isn't easy to get a good sleep when you are depressed. Try to keep a regular schedule, avoid bright screens for two hours prior to going to bed, and create a relaxing bedroom routine.

Meditation is an easy and effective way to reduce stress and boost your mood. There are a variety of meditation. It is important to select one that suits your needs. Start with simple practices such as deep breathing, counting breaths, or picturing a positive phrase or image.
